Full Description
Decision Making for Initial Company Operations is designed to develop the decision making skills to accomplish assigned tactics at structure fires. All activities and scenarios used in this course are based on structure fires. As a Company Officer (CO) with the real possibility of being the first to arrive at an incident, the CO's initial decisions will have an impact throughout the entire incident. It is vital that they be able to make good management decisions that have a favorable impact on the eventual outcome. In addition to a possible role as the initial Incident Commander (IC), the CO may well be assigned a subordinate position within the ICS organization. CO's need to have a clear understanding of the system, the position they are assigned and their role in the organization if they are to function effectively and help make the system work.
This course is specifically designed for newly appointed Company Officers, or firefighters who may have acting Company Officer responsibilities or who want to become a Company Officer. This course is an excellent review for experienced Company Officers.

HARDWARE REQUIREMENTS FOR TEAMS ON A WINDOWS PC
Computer and processor: Minimum 1.6 GHz (or higher) (32-bit or 64-bit). Memory 2.0 GB RAM, Hard disk 3.0 GB of available disk space, Graphics hardware Minimum of 128 MB graphics memory.
Devices: Standard laptop camera, microphone, and headphones/ear buds.
For a better experience with online meetings, we recommend using a computer that has a dual-core processor and 8.0 GB RAM (or higher).
The optional Background video effects are not supported on processors without an AVX2 instruction set running on Windows 8.1 or below.

HARDWARE REQUIREMENTS FOR TEAMS ON MOBILE DEVICES
Android: Compatible with Android phones and tablets. Support is limited to the last four major versions of Android. When a new major version of Android is released, the new version and the previous three versions are officially supported.
iOS: Compatible with iPhone, iPad, and iPod touch. Support is limited to the two most recent major versions of iOS. When a new major version of iOS is released, the new version of iOS and the previous version are officially supported. The optional Blur my background video effect on iOS requires an operating system of iOS 12 or later and is compatible with the following devices: iPhone 7 or later, iPad 2018 (6th generation) or later, and the iPod touch 2019 (7th generation).

For the best experience with Teams, use the latest version of iOS and Android.
